KWXL-LP

Radio station in Tucson, Arizona
32°10′59″N 110°58′39″W / 32.18306°N 110.97750°W / 32.18306; -110.97750

KWXL-LP (98.7 FM) is a high school radio station broadcasting a variety format. Licensed to Tucson, Arizona, United States, the station serves the Tucson area. The station is currently owned by the Tucson Unified School District.[1] KWXL-LP is Tucson's only high school radio station. It is also a news radio station for students who attend Pueblo High Magnet School. Students broadcasting over the radio station are enrolled in a "Writing/Reporting for Broadcasting" class with instructor Sarah Wilson. Originally started by Douglas Potter, who retired in 2006.[2] Listeners can also find FM 98.7, KWXL on iTunes.
